WASHINGTON, July 21 -- The Government Accountability Office issued a series of ten bid protest decisions associated with concerns raised by potential government contractors over the award of federal contracts. This week, the GAO's general counsel, which handles the bid protests, issued ten bid protest decisions. Three protests were sustained, seven were denied/dismissed:

* Carahsoft Technology Corporation; Allied Technology Group v. General Services Administration B-311241; B-311241.2, May 16). http://www.gao.gov/decisions/bidpro/311241.htm. Carahsoft and Allied protest the decision not to include services for compensation management in the award of Federal ...
